The atomic number of an element ' M ' is 26. How many electrons are present in the M -shell of the element in its M³⁺ state ?
Options
- A11
- B15
- C14
- D13
Correct answer
D. 13
Step-by-step solution
array l|c|c|c|c & K & L & M & N M (26) & 1 s^2, & 2 s^2 2 p^6, & 3 s^2 3 p^6 3 d^6 & 4 s^2 M ³⁺ & 1 s^2, & 2 s^2 2 p^6, & 3 s^2 3 p^6 3 d^5, & 4 s^0 array Hence, 13 electrons are present in the M -shell of M³⁺ state.
